This brings us to the core of Kuta’s healing allure: the traditional Balinese massage. Whether you choose a simple, invigorating massage right on the beach, listening to the waves lap at the shore, or opt for a luxurious spa experience, the essence remains the same. Balinese massage is an ancient healing art, a blend of gentle stretches, long, flowing strokes, skin rolling, and acupressure, all performed with aromatic essential oils like frangipani, jasmine, or sandalwood. Therapists use their hands, forearms, and even elbows to ease muscle tension, improve circulation, and promote a deep sense of relaxation. Travel Tips: Navigating Your Balinese Escape

To make the most of your Pantai Kuta adventure, here are some practical insights.

Best Time to Visit: The dry season, from April to October, offers ideal weather with plenty of sunshine and minimal rain, perfect for beach activities and exploring. Shoulder seasons (April-May and September-October) are often delightful, with pleasant weather and slightly fewer crowds, offering a more serene experience.

How to Get There: Ngurah Rai International Airport (DPS) is conveniently located just a 15-20 minute drive from Kuta. Taxis are readily available, or you can pre-book an airport transfer. Ride-hailing apps like Gojek and Grab are also popular and efficient ways to get around Bali.

Entrance Fees: Access to Pantai Kuta itself is free. You might incur small parking fees if you arrive by scooter or car. Prices for Balinese massages vary widely, from around 80,000 IDR (approx. $5 USD) for a simple beach massage to upwards of 300,000 IDR ($20 USD) or more for a luxurious spa treatment.

Nearby Attractions: Beyond Kuta’s immediate vicinity, consider a short trip to Legian and Seminyak for upscale dining, boutique shopping, and trendy beach clubs. The Tanah Lot Temple, a stunning sea temple, is also a popular half-day excursion, particularly at sunset.

When hunger strikes, you’re in for a treat! Local food specialties are abundant. Indulge in fresh seafood BBQ right on the beach, savor the rich flavors of Nasi Goreng (fried rice) or Mie Goreng (fried noodles), and don’t miss Sate Lilit, minced seafood or chicken skewers grilled on lemongrass stalks. For a truly local experience, try a "warung" – a traditional eatery offering authentic Balinese dishes at incredible prices.

Looking for unique souvenirs to bring home? Kuta’s markets and shops are treasure troves. Think beautifully printed sarongs, intricate wood carvings, delicate silver jewelry, aromatic Balinese coffee, and locally produced spices. Remember, a little friendly bargaining is expected and part of the fun!
